SHELEKHOV

Dry bulk / Mini bulkers 1, IMO 8721519

SHELEKHOV is currently in Tekirdag, last seen less than 1h ago

The vessel was built in 1988, and is sailing under the flag of Panama. Her length overall (LOA) is 116 meters, and her width (beam) is 13 meters. Her summer deadweight capacity is 3,332 tonnes.
